By photo editing, do you mean a RAW editor alternative to Lightroom? Darktable, RAWTherapee, DaVinci Resolve, AfterShot Pro, and the unhelpfully named "Art" [1] are all options for that. For something to replace Photoshop, Affinity can be made to run in Wine, and their CEO is open to the idea of a native port.
